He has played senior football for FC Lienden and Greenock Morton, after coming through the youth systems of HFC Haarlem and PSV Eindhoven.

As a regular in the Jong PSV side, he was on the verge on breaking into the first team, making the bench in an Eredivisie game in 2009.

[1] He joined FC Lienden in the Dutch third tier[2] in 2013[3] to regain his fitness after a serious injury before moving to Scotland to join up with NLSL Premier Football Coaching, from where he and Ricardo Talu earned trials at Greenock Morton.

[4] In August 2015, Sabajo received international clearance to sign for Morton after a three-week wait.

[6] On his return to The Netherlands, Sabajo signed for lower league side VPV Purmersteijn.
